Akinator logo Akinator

Akinator is an entertainment app that acts like a digital genie that can read your mind. The game will ask you a few questions about the character you have chosen, and it will attempt to guess the character from your provided answers.

Ludo logo Ludo

Ludo is a platform for playing online team building games in the workplace. We built Ludo as a tool to help us bring our teams and people together. Ludo uses games inspired by popular social games like Werewolf (that we ourselves have a love for).
